"We shall fight on the beaches" is a common title given to a speech delivered by the British Prime Minister Winston Churchill to the House of Commons of the Parliament of the United Kingdom on 4 June 1940. This was the second of three major speeches given around the period of the Battle of France; the … See more Winston Churchill took over as Prime Minister on 10 May 1940, eight months after the outbreak of World War II in Europe. http://jultika.oulu.fi/files/nbnfioulu-202409182881.pdf WebMar 18, 2024 · “We Shall Fight on the Beaches” by Winston Churchill (1940): This speech was given by the British Prime Minister during World War II, following the evacuation of British and Allied troops from Dunkirk. It rallied the British people and called for their unwavering commitment to the war effort against Nazi Germany.
